Bayern and CSKA Moscow are both domestic champions.Preview: Bayern begin title defence against Russian Champions

The Bayern side led by the legendary Jupp Heynckes won a historical treble last season which they rounded off with a victory over rivals Borussia Dortmund in the Champions League final at Wembley.

Whereas incoming Pep Guardiola will find it difficult to repeat the feat, he will be hoping to make Bayern the only German side to retain the Champions League crown.

 

The German giants have been one of the most threatening sides in Europe in recent years having made three Champions League final appearances in the last four years. Their new manager and former Barcelona coach is no stranger to European success having won two Champions League titles with the Catalans in 2009 and 2011.

In a Bayern side which already had a plethora of attacking talent after an incredible treble last season, Pep added to their ranks two of the most brightest prospects in world football in the shape of Mario Gotze  and Thiago Alcantara.

However unfortunately for Bayern, the prolific duo will miss out on Tuesday’s clash as they nurse ankle injuries. Also out of the tie is Spanish midfielder Javi Martinez who is suffering from a groin injury.
The Bavarians have begun this season’s Bundesliga strongly having managed four victories in the five matches played so far, but play second fiddle to rivals Borussia Dortmund who have managed a perfect win rate so far having won all of their five matches.

Recently crowned UEFA Best Player in Europe  Franck Ribéry will be Bayern’s player to watch out for. The Frenchman has managed two goals and an assist in the German league so far and has been one of Bayern’s most influential players so far this season.

His goal against Chelsea in the European Super Cup match was integral in guiding the Bavarians to the Super Cup crown earlier in the season.

Whereas Bayern are definitely the stronger side on paper, CSKA will prove to be competitive opponents. Leonid Slutsky's  who won the Russian Premier League last season are currently top of the table in this year’s Russian League having managed six victories and two draws in the eight matches they have played so far.

The Russian outfit has tasted European success only once, having won the UEFA Cup back in 2005. However they have gone only as far as the Quarter Finals as far as Champions League is concerned, which was back in 2010 when they defeated Sevilla 3-2 on aggregate.

Nigerian international Ahmed Musa is the team’s top scorer having scored five goals so far in the Russian League, Seydou Doumbia is just one goal behind having scored four times for his side.

CSKA Moscow have a talented midfield with Keisuke Honda, Alan Dzagoev and Zoran Tosic in the side. However they will certainly find it difficult to contain a Bayern midfield which is composed of the finest players currently in the world of football.
